Damaris and Alberto live in an isolated village in the Sierra Maestra Mountains of Cuba. Four months ago, their 12 year old son committed suicide.
2015
1917
—
1965
1900
2012
2007
1974
2020
1914
1960
2014
2025
2017
2005
1912
2013
2024